EL girl won tickets to see Miley Cyrus
By KATIE SCHWENDEMAN/kschwendeman@reviewonline.comEAST LIVERPOOL - Last month Bob Duffy and his family decided to eat dinner at O'Charley's in Boardman. Little did they know that they would be eating there every Wednesday for the next four weeks, thanks to HOT 101 FM radio based out of Youngstown.
On the night that Bob, his wife Michelle and his seven-year-old daughter Emily stopped at O'Charley's, the radio station was there as part of a promotional campaign they were doing for an upcoming Miley Cyrus concert. Anyone eating at the restaurant every Wednesday night for four weeks improved their chances of winning tickets to see Miley Cyrus in concert at the Cleveland Quicken Loans Arena, as well as dinner at O'Charley's via limousine escort. The limousine would pick up the winner at their home and then transport them to the restaurant, and later the concert. After the concert the limousine would then transport the winner back home.
Bob Duffy said the first night that he and his family went to O'Charley's and found out what was going on, his daughter asked if they could get involved in the drawing. Four weeks and several drawings later, Emily's chances of winning the tickets kept getting better. "We finally came to the last week and Emily had three entries out of 25 in the box. They drew the first six entries to eliminate them, and one by one DJ AC announced the names. Finally, at 6:30 p.m. it was announced that Emily Duffy was the grand prize winner," Duffy said. The final drawing took place Wednesday, Nov. 4.
Emily won four tickets to the concert, and was picked up by a limousine at 2:30 p.m. on Sunday at her home. She was then taken to O'Charley's for dinner and then to Quicken Loans Arena for the concert that started at 7 p.m.
According to Duffy, when Emily realized she was grand prize winner, she acted like someone who was going to see The Beatles. "She screamed when she won. This is big time for her," he said.
